(IraqiNews.com) BAGHDAD – At least 80 people were killed and around 230 injured when suicide bombers attacked a large demonstration in the Afghan capital of Kabul. This was informed by an official from the Ministry of Public Health of Afghanistan on Saturday.

Mohammad Ismail Kawousi, a spokesman of the Ministry said “At least 80 people were killed and 230 injured in a suicide attack on a demonstration in Kabul. The dead and injured have been taken to nearby hospitals.”

ISIS, in a statement issued through its affiliated news agency Aamaq, claimed responsibility of the attack.

The protesters, mostly ethnic minority Hazaras, were marching to demand that their impoverished home province be included in a major new electricity line. Most Hazaras are Shiite Muslims, while most Afghans are Sunni.

It may be mentioned here that the attack is one of the deadliest in Afghanistan since the Taliban launched a violent insurgency in 2001.
